What is the traditional food of Italy that consists of dough-filled pockets? 🔊
The traditional food of Italy that consists of dough-filled pockets is known as ravioli. Ravioli are pasta squares or rounds filled with various ingredients, which can include cheese, meats, vegetables, or seafood. They are typically served in a variety of sauces, such as marinara or creamy sauces, and can be boiled or baked. This dish has a long history in Italian cuisine, cherished for its versatility and richness in flavor. Ravioli can be found in regional variations across Italy, reflecting local ingredients and culinary traditions, making them a beloved staple in Italian households and restaurants.
